More about Certificate III in Automotive Body Repair Technology

For those seeking a rewarding career in the automotive industry, the Certificate III in Automotive Body Repair Technology offers an invaluable qualification. Situated in Griffith, New South Wales, this course equips students with the essential skills and knowledge needed to excel in various automotive roles. Local training providers, including MTA Institute, MTA NSW, Kangan Institute, CIT, and TAFE NSW, deliver the course through online modes, making it accessible for students across the region.

The Certificate III in Automotive Body Repair Technology is linked to several key fields, including Manufacturing, Trades, and Automotive. By enrolling in this program, students can explore a dynamic learning environment that prepares them for exciting career opportunities in Griffith and beyond. The comprehensive curriculum covers essential topics, ensuring that graduates are well-prepared for the demands of the automotive industry.

Students who successfully complete the Certificate III in Automotive Body Repair Technology can pursue various roles, such as Windscreen Fitters, Spray Painters, and Automotive Service Technicians. These roles provide an opportunity to work in a fast-paced environment, where hands-on experience and technical skills are essential for success. Other potential job roles include Panel Beaters, Car Detailers, and Vehicle Body Builders, each contributing to the repair and restoration of vehicles.

The local automotive industry in Griffith recognises the importance of skilled professionals, making the Certificate III in Automotive Body Repair Technology a sought-after qualification. Graduates may also choose to explore further opportunities as Automotive Body Repair Apprentices or Automotive Refinishers, roles that not only offer career progression but also the potential for a rewarding future in this continually evolving sector.
